Meet Cher--she lives in Beverly Hills with her father, has her wardrobe on computer, and drives a Jeep even though she doesn't have a license. She wants to do good--like arranging for two of her teachers to fall in love or rescuing a New York transplant from teenage hell. Her plans go awry when she realizes that the guy she's picked for a friend may be the guy of her dreams.
